NAME


geneparse - sequence file loader frontend

SYNAPSE


geneparse [options...] [input] [input2 ...] #read input and write to stdout

DESCRIPTION


Reads a sequence file and writes it somewhere (by default to stdout).

A specific range within an input file can be specified by file[start,stop]. The square
brackets can be interchanged for any of {[()]}, (eg. "genome.fa[3000,4000]" or
"genome.fa{3000~4000}"). Be aware that all of those might be parsed by your shell. Also
any non-word character can be used to separate the numbers.

OPTIONS


--repeatmask|-r
use soft-repeatmasked sequences (ie: replace lowercase bases with N's).

--upper|--unmask|-U
uppercase all bases.

--length|-l
just print the length and exit

--clean|-c
don't append a new line when finished

--version|-V
prints the program version

--help|-h
prints a help message

--output|-o
send output to a file (otherwise use stdout). --output implies --clean.

--quiet|-q
silence all warnings

--verbose|-v
prints lots of extra details
